Charging the Battery
The best way to charge the battery is to plug your Sero 8 into a wall
outlet using the power adapter and Micro-USB cable included with your
accessories.

The Sero 8 also charges slowly when you connect it to the USB port on your
computer. The battery may drain instead of charge when the battery usage
is large.
